title: Development of Safety-Critical Control Systems in Event-B Using FMEA creator: Prokhorova, Yuliya creator: Troubitsyna, Elena creator: Laibinis, Linas creator: Kharchenko, Vyacheslav subject: Event-B subject: Resilience subject: Event-B Examples description: Application of formal methods, in particular Event-B, helps us to build control systems correct by construction. On the other hand, to guarantee safety of such a system, we need to incorporate safety and fault tolerance requirements into its formal specification. In this chapter, we demonstrate how to integrate the results obtained during fault analysis, specifically, failure mode and effect analysis (FMEA), into the control system development process in Event-B. The proposed methodology is exemplified by a case study. publisher: IGI Global contributor: Stolen, Ketil contributor: Nadj-Tehrani, Simin contributor: Damsgaard Jensen , Christian contributor: Vain, Juri date: 2011 type: Book Section type: PeerReviewed identifier: Prokhorova, Yuliya and Troubitsyna, Elena and Laibinis, Linas and Kharchenko, Vyacheslav (2011) Development of Safety-Critical Control Systems in Event-B Using FMEA.
